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3412063116 34149 823844 18035764110 108
10149417 93
10149417 93
559562479 09 254 583 60460521
All about undefined
Interested in learning more?
10149417 93
559562479 09 254 583 60460521
See more
222358594 3441
24302 81 003
See more
6520430 8708
71746435184 272503 38 4972512806 20611341
See more